(Nashville, Tenn.) July 13, 2011— GRAMMY® nominated worship artist Matt Redman’s newest project, 10,000 Reasons, available nationwide, is receiving praise from critics across the board. The album also made a strong debut upon its release, dominating the charts by taking the No. 1 spot on iTunes ® Christian Albums Chart and placing in the Top 15 on iTunes ® overall albums chart. 10,000 Reasons adds eleven new worship anthems to Redman’s catalogue that already includes favorites sung in churches worldwide such as “Blessed Be Your Name,” “Heart of Worship,” and “You Never Let Go.”

The new album, with songs co-written by Jonas Myrin (“Our God,” “You Alone Can Rescue”) and Jason Ingram (“Give Me Your Eyes,” “By Your Side”), is already proving to be a hit with an extensive online and print feature in Christianity Today, along with receiving critical acclaim from New Release Tuesday, About.com, Worship Leader Magazine and more as evidenced below:

10,000 Reasons is one of the best worship albums of the year. Matt Redman enthusiastically sings Brit-rock style praise and worship and every single song could be added to your Sunday morning worship set.” -New Release Tuesday

“Sincere and honest lyrics, unquestionable passion, an authenticity that plugs you right into the Throne Room, exquisite musicianship ... and that is just touching the tip of the iceberg!” –About.com

10,000 Reasons is a worship experience. Ultimately, Matt Redman realized his strongest sense of self on this project: the self only truly found in transparent, vulnerable cries of self-surrender.” –Worship Leader Magazine

In support the album’s first single, “Never Once,” which is making its mark at radio now, Redman recently visited radio stations KLOVE and KSBJ. Earlier this week, Redman also presented his new project to numerous radio personnel at a special event held in Atlanta.

While in Atlanta, he took some time to lead worship at his home church in the U.S., Passion City Church, pastored by Passion founder and director Louie Giglio.

About Matt Redman:
Matt Redman’s songwriting is synonymous with integrity and continues to impact churches around the world. Leading a generation of worshipers, his songs have been recorded by Chris Tomlin, Michael W. Smith, David Crowder*Band, Rebecca St. James, Tree 63, Kutless and Passion among others. A key songwriter for today’s church, an active worship leader for Passion conferences around the world, Redman has a history of success having garnered seven Gospel Music Association Dove Awards and recently received a GRAMMY ® nod for “Best Gospel Song” for “Our God” featured on Passion: Awakening. Additionally, Redman has 21 songs in the CCLI Top 500, with 5 populating the Top 50. Redman's eighth album, 10,000 Reasons, releases July 12 on sixstepsrecords.

About sixstepsrecords:
Founded in 2000 by Louie Giglio, sixstepsrecords ( http://www.sixstepsrecords.com) is a worship label and a division of Passion Conferences. sixstepsrecords’ artists include Chris Tomlin (And If Our God Is For Us…), David Crowder* Band (Church Music), Charlie Hall (The Rising), Matt Redman (10,000 Reasons), Christy Nockels (Life Light Up), Kristian Stanfill (Mountains Move), and Passion (Passion: Here For You). The label partners with Sparrow Records/EMI CMG Label Group for A&R, marketing, sales and distribution operations.
